Yiew Chatmongkol Defends Wife Jeanny Over Criticism
Yiew Chatmongkol Samkaew, husband of singer Jeanny, fires back at online critics accusing her of making content, as legal action is prepared.

Following a wave of public criticism suggesting that the parties should settle their issues privately, along with allegations from netizens accusing her of staging content, Jeanny stepped forward to clarify the situation and firmly announced her intention to file formal police reports against the thief as well as individuals producing clips and malicious comments intended to defame her.

The situation escalated further when Yiew Chatmongkol Samkaew, Jeanny's husband, took to social media to post a sharp and aggressive message defending his wife. He described the most pitiful type of person as someone who suffers, harbors resentment, and feels absolute agony when witnessing others achieve happiness and success, concluding with a fiery remark.
"บุคคลประเภทที่น่าสงสาร และน่าสมเพชเวทนาที่สุด คือ คนที่เป็นทุกข์ รังเกียจ เคียดแค้น ทรมานแสนสาหัส เมื่อเห็นคนอื่นได้ดีมีความสุข จุกอกตาxไปเลยจะได้พ้นทุกข์ 👋🏻"
Furthermore, the husband added another comment beneath his post, asserting that if Jeanny lacked genuine talent and fame, her career would have faded long ago. He maintained that every milestone of her success was achieved through her own efforts without needing to cling to anyone else for attention, while sharply rebuking critics who constantly look for angles to undermine her reputation.
